Mental masculinity is linked with hormones and neurochemistry which are affected by behaviour, diet, lifestyle etc. so I'd suggest living healthy in general and "acting like a man" in any way you can think of:
>taking up a combat sport
>being more competitive in general
>being more ambitious
>spend more time in male company (if you don't already)
>being more self-reliant
>looking out for others
>challenging yourself
>being more confident, less inhibited
>putting yourself through hardship
>making sure you've earned what you have

if you want to read I'd suggest reading about warrior cultures like the germanic tribes, vikings, sparta etc. and roman society (before it started declining) - /his/ or /lit/ should be able to help with that. There's the viking sagas and the Iliad if you're up to reading the source texts, again /lit/ and /his/ should help you work out how to do that. I'd say reading about warrior cultures might work as a way of taking you outside the modern mindset, although acting on what you learn is necessary.

Read these for life gains

Flow - Mihaly Csikszentmihalyi
Thinking Fast and Slow - Daniel Kahneman
The Power of Habit - Charles Duhigg
Seven Habits of Highly Effective People - Stephen Covey
